![]() ![]() The 38 th book in this long-running series, Unnatural History was another exceptional read with a fantastic case behind it. As such, the Alex Delaware books are one series that I will always make sure to grab as soon as it is out, and this includes the latest entry, Unnatural History. All the Alex Delaware novels I have so far read, including The Wedding Guest, The Museum of Desire, Serpentine and City of Dead, have been just outstanding, and the complex and fascinating murder investigations have all been very strongly written and particularly compelling to follow. This is a very solid and captivating series, and I personally love all the clever and distinctive mysteries that Kellerman keeps coming up with.
